The Rise and Fall of PTI's Popularity

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) witnessed a period of staggering growth in popularity, fueled by its charismatic leader Imran Khan and promises of transformation. Its message found fertile ground with the Pakistani public, who were seeking for an alternative to the status quo. The party achieved a landslide victory in the 2018 general elections, capturing power and setting out on its daring agenda.

However, PTI's popularity waned over time due to a combination of factors, including economic challenges, political rift, and allegations of corruption. Public trust in the government eroded, leading to demonstrations and condemnation from both within and outside Pakistan. The party's capacity to fulfill its promises was cast into doubt, ultimately contributing to its decline.
